Rosberg will stick with Williams

Rosberg will stick with Williams

22 November 2007

Williams F1 driver Nico Rosberg has said he will not leave the team at the end of the season. The German will stick with his team for a third season and has no intention to join any other team. Rosberg was linked with the McLaren team to become Hamilton's team-mate but Rosberg only sees himself at Williams in 2008.

"I am staying here, I'm only 22 and am not rushed yet," Rosberg told The Telegraph. "I can pace my career but I want to start being on the podium next season."

Formula One is waiting for Renault and McLaren to announce its full 2008 driver line-up.
